**Responsibilities & Key Deliverables**
- Key Responsibilities:

**Due Diligence Process**:
Perform detailed due diligence on potential dealers, ensuring that all risks (financial, legal, and operational) are identified and mitigated before forming partnerships.
Collect and Analyze data to identify key risks associated with dealer partnerships.
Maintain and update a database of due diligence findings and create reports for senior management on dealer assessments.
**Risk Management**:
Identify red flags and inconsistencies during evaluations, and work with senior management to address potential risks.
Recommend corrective actions to improve dealer performance and mitigate risks.
**Dealer Evaluation**:
Conduct comprehensive studies of existing dealers’ financial reports, assessing their financial stability, business practices, and operational efficiency.
Analyze dealer sales performance trends and throw alerts.
Assess dealer compliance with regulatory standards, contractual obligations, and internal policies.
**Collaboration & Communication**:
Work closely with legal, compliance, finance, and sales teams to ensure alignment in dealer evaluations and due diligence processes.
Prepare and present due diligence reports and recommendations to senior management, helping them make informed decisions about dealer partnerships.
Maintain organized records of all dealer evaluations, due diligence reports, and relevant documentation.
